diff options
Diffstat (limited to 'configure.in')
-rw-r--r-- | configure.in | 38 |
1 files changed, 28 insertions, 10 deletions
diff --git a/configure.in b/configure.in index f821a414e..448ef60f0 100644 --- a/configure.in +++ b/configure.in @@ -193,28 +193,46 @@ AC_SUBST(DATDEST) AC_SUBST(MODULE_PATH) AC_ARG_WITH(ircd, [ --with-ircd=ircd Specify the first ircd type], [ - if test "$withval" = "IRC_DREAMFORGE"; then - AC_DEFINE(IRC_DREAMFORGE,1,"Frist IRCD type") - elif test "$withval" = "IRC_BAHAMUT"; then + if test "$withval" = "IRC_BAHAMUT"; then AC_DEFINE(IRC_BAHAMUT,1,"First IRCD type") + IRCDFILE=" bahamut.c " + AC_SUBST(IRCDFILE) elif test "$withval" = "IRC_UNREAL31"; then - AC_DEFINE(IRC_UNREAL31,1,"First IRCD type") + AC_DEFINE(IRC_UNREAL31,1,"First IRCD type") + IRCDFILE=" unreal31.c " + AC_SUBST(IRCDFILE) elif test "$withval" = "IRC_ULTIMATE2"; then - AC_DEFINE(IRC_ULTIMATE2,1,"First IRCD type") + AC_DEFINE(IRC_ULTIMATE2,1,"First IRCD type") + IRCDFILE=" ultimate2.c " + AC_SUBST(IRCDFILE) elif test "$withval" = "IRC_ULTIMATE3"; then - AC_DEFINE(IRC_ULTIMATE3,1,"First IRCD type") + AC_DEFINE(IRC_ULTIMATE3,1,"First IRCD type") + IRCDFILE=" ultimate3.c " + AC_SUBST(IRCDFILE) elif test "$withval" = "IRC_HYBRID"; then AC_DEFINE(IRC_HYBRID,1,"First IRCD type") + IRCDFILE=" hybrid.c " + AC_SUBST(IRCDFILE) elif test "$withval" = "IRC_VIAGRA"; then - AC_DEFINE(IRC_VIAGRA,1,"First IRCD type") + AC_DEFINE(IRC_VIAGRA,1,"First IRCD type") + IRCDFILE=" viagra.c " + AC_SUBST(IRCDFILE) elif test "$withval" = "IRC_PTLINK"; then AC_DEFINE(IRC_PTLINK,1,"First IRCD type") + IRCDFILE=" ptlink.c " + AC_SUBST(IRCDFILE) elif test "$withval" = "IRC_RAGE2"; then - AC_DEFINE(IRC_RAGE2,1,"First IRCD type") + AC_DEFINE(IRC_RAGE2,1,"First IRCD type") + IRCDFILE=" rageircd.c " + AC_SUBST(IRCDFILE) elif test "$withval" = "IRC_UNREAL32"; then - AC_DEFINE(IRC_UNREAL32,1,"First IRCD type") + AC_DEFINE(IRC_UNREAL32,1,"First IRCD type") + IRCDFILE=" unreal32.c " + AC_SUBST(IRCDFILE) elif test "$withval" = "IRC_SOLID"; then - AC_DEFINE(IRC_SOLID,1,"First IRCD type") + AC_DEFINE(IRC_SOLID,1,"First IRCD type") + IRCDFILE=" solidircd.c " + AC_SUBST(IRCDFILE) fi ]) |